EERE's Geothermal Technologies Program works in partnership with U.S. industry to establish geothermal energy as an economically competitive contributor to the U.S. energy supply. For more information on the Geothermal Technologies Program's key activities, see About the Program.

New Geothermal FundingThe Geothermal Technologies Program expects to receive additional funds through the American Recovery and Reinvestment Act of 2009.
